FAQs - booking Phoenix flights

  • Is there an on-site hotel at Phoenix Sky Harbor Intl Airport?

    While there is no on-site hotel, if you are arriving late and want to fall straight into bed you can book a room at an establishment close to the airport. Aloft Phoenix Airport is located close to the PHX Sky Train terminal and also offers a free shuttle, while the Hilton Garden Inn Phoenix Airport and Hyatt Place Tempe Phoenix Airport are both 8min away and offer free transfers upon request.

  • What is the fastest way to get from Phoenix Airport to the city centre?

    Downtown Phoenix is under 4 mi from Phoenix Sky Harbor Intl Airport and takes around 10min to access by car. Taxis are available 24/7 outside the terminals and operate on a flat rate of $17 (£13) to Downtown, while shared van services provide another quick mode of transport for around $12-46 (£9-35) per person, depending on your destination. Prefer public transport? The PHX Sky Train connects to Valley Metro light rail station, which runs services to the city centre every 12-20min and costs $2 (£1.50) for a single journey.

  • Where can I get a late-night bite to eat at Phoenix Sky Harbor Intl Airport?

    There are plenty of food and drink shops to choose from at the airport, including several that are open 24h for travellers on late flights to Phoenix. Premiere Grab & Go in Terminal 2, Peet’s Coffee in Terminal 3, and Starbucks and Wildflower Bread Company in Terminal 4 are all located pre-security so accessible to passengers arriving and departing.

  • What facilities does Phoenix Sky Harbor Intl Airport offer for families?

    Passengers on flights to Phoenix with young children will find the usual family restrooms and nursing stations available in each terminal building. Slightly older children can let off steam at the play areas located airside in each terminal, and there are plenty of toyshops available for last-minute entertainment.

  • Phoenix Sky Harbor Intl Airport (PHX) has plenty to keep travellers entertained. Take in a bit of local culture by visiting the Airport Museum exhibitions, which include works of art and aviation history.
  • The PHX Sky Train is a convenient way of getting around this large airport – while Terminals 2 and 3 are connected by a covered walkway, passengers transferring from Terminal 3 to 4 will need to take the free people mover shuttle.
  • Travellers with pets on flights to Phoenix can make use of several pet relief areas. Located both in-terminal beyond security and outdoors in public areas, they are equipped with drinking water, relief areas and space in which to walk.
  • Charging points are available throughout the terminals at Phoenix Sky Harbor Intl Airport, offering both USB ports and classic plug sockets. Make use of comfortable seating at the lobby charging tables or one of the "Get Plugged In" kiosks.
  • Feeling thirsty after your flight to Phoenix? Drinking water fountains offering bottle refill functions are available at various points throughout the terminals.
  • Flights to Phoenix can be long, so if you feel the need to stretch your legs, the airport has you covered. The FitPHX walking path links Gates A and D in Terminal 4 to help you get your circulation going again.
